Ticket: Missed pick-up — seed samples, Trial Plot 4

Hey Marholt Station team, the courier from Greenquill Logistics didn't show yesterday for the Verdanta seed sample crates, so they're still sitting in your cold room. We've rebooked for tomorrow morning before 10. Please keep the crates sealed and at the logged temperature until then — the trial coordinator, Petra Lindqvist, was clear that the germination window is tight. The replacement driver will need the confidential hand-over instruction below.

dispatch memo: the eliath belael courier leaves the praox ledger at gate 8841 under passcode 017589

Welcome aboard. DeltaScope is our diff viewer for very large files, and its chunked rendering pipeline is the most fragile part of the codebase. Before changing anything under `src/chunker/` or `src/virtual-scroll/`, please read the design notes in `docs/architecture.md` and run the full benchmark suite against the 2GB fixture set. Changes to memory-mapping behavior require sign-off, no exceptions, because regressions here have broken production twice. All questions, reviews, and escalations for this component go to the current owner.

account owner for bawip-tahag: Raleth Quenok

## Step 4: Swap in the queue-depth autoscaler

Okay, this is the fiddly part. Retire the old CPU-based scaler on Brindlehop before enabling the new queue-depth autoscaler, or they'll fight each other and you'll get flapping replicas all afternoon (ask anyone on the Tidewell team). Drain the workers, flip the feature flag, then redeploy. The thresholds below came from two weeks of load testing, so don't eyeball new ones. Apply the following configuration values to the autoscaler before restarting:

deployment values, yafop-tahof:
HOLIX_HOST=holix.zemvarsys.internal
HOLIX_PORT=3306

Handover note — Marit to Deyan

Quick flag before you take over the commercial desk: Vellanor Foods now accounts for roughly 58% of Brightquay Logistics' revenue. If they renegotiate or walk, we're exposed badly. I've started conversations with two mid-size prospects in the Haldwick region, but nothing signed. Keep the account team calm — no panic signals to the client. The mitigation thinking so far is summarised in the note below.

board note of fahif-yahog: Gross margin on Wenath came in at 10 percent against a plan of 5 percent. Only 3 of the 100 pilot accounts renewed Wenath, so a churn review is set for July 15.